April 27-May 1 2026

Monday Char had a game in Crystal River. We decided to explore Crystal River beforehand. We launched at Petes Pier and checked out Shell Island. Skirted around and found reds on a muddy point North of the mouth of the river. Fished about the last 2 hours of outgoing tide…..skunked

Tuesday we checked out the Chassahowitzka to see if we could scout and find Tarpon. We found some on points south of Chassahowitzka point. Spooked them so we moved to where I caught reds the previous Friday.
Skunked again!

Wednesday, Lily had her final high school softball game in Crystal River so I started the day at Pete‘s pier again with a good friend of mine.

I caught a flats slam in about 15 minutes of incoming tide off Shell Island point.

We caught short reds, short snook and a keeper trout for one of my customers that likes fish. Found lots of sheepshead off Rocky points with deep nearby water. Sean got broke off on a huge shark later that day on a mullet head, I chucked out on my tarpon rod. That was exciting!
I filleted the leftover mullet and gave that to another customer that likes to make Mullet dip.

Thursday was a busy work day but we managed to go out to Homosassa for one last shot at Snook season.
We ended up with a short snook, a flounder and some jacks out around the mouth of the little homosassa river at the last of the outgoing tide.

Friday…..yup we made it out Friday.
Went back to Shell Island and set up with live bait. Caught a 19” flounder on live shrimp and some short mangrove snapper. After about 2 hours I had to pick up the sweetheart and get some chow at crab plant in Crystal River. Headed back out like any addict would do and snooped around the oyster bars with the outgoing tide. Ended up with another snook and some small mangrove snapper.

Your work week isn’t gonna correlate with Fishing often so get out whenever you can. My best luck this week was showing up at low tide and fishing the incoming tide around the points. Lil’ Jons on a chartreuse jighead, about anything salt strong makes in white. And if all else fails, get shrimp under a popping cork, chill out and hydrate.

Friday Fishing Report!!!!

Light wind from the South East today, worked jigs and paddle tails. Caught short reds and short trout. One 19” trout and one 28” redfish.
